As we celebrate Nikki’s fifth anniversary with Sail Newport, we recognize the depth of experience she brought with her in arts, entertainment, and event production. Before joining the team, Nikki built a strong foundation in artist relations and large-scale event. operations, contributing to music festivals, live venues, and tourism-based experiences.
Her background includes key management roles with the Beach Road Weekend Music Festival in Martha’s Vineyard, Innovation Arts and Entertainment in Chicago, Aquamarine Adventures in St. Maarten, and the Pabst Theater Group and Summerfest in Milwaukee as well as a leadership role with Empire Tea & Coffee in Newport.
